Output 75ec061383faa2a045a09863df0bf3b06ffe3dbbf7ecd932beda7c9e3c2ad98c:1

value
1421537
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 532cc28f56c4906f1f5b4389e4e309f36bc9c06b OP_EQUALVERIFY OP_CHECKSIG
address
18anhuGiduZfQTk5ozs4aTXcU17t7Y84WF
transaction
75ec061383faa2a045a09863df0bf3b06ffe3dbbf7ecd932beda7c9e3c2ad98c
confirmations
346864
spent
true